People familiar with the matter say the Trump administration is preparing to reduce the White House’s 25% tariff on Canadian car imports to 15% as part of a broader deal in which Canada would withdraw retaliatory trade measures. The 25% levy, imposed last year on foreign-made cars and trucks, is applied only to the non-U.S. content of vehicles produced in Canada and Mexico; sources say the proposed 15% rate would use the same non-U.S. content calculation. Terms are not finalized and the outcome remains uncertain; Trump has previously modified or uncertain canceled trade agreements at late stages.
